Sufi Metaphor of the Mole (Khaal) in Golshan-e Raz

In Mahmud Shabestari's Golshan-e Raz, the 'mole' (خال - Khaal) on the beloved's cheek serves as a profound Sufi allegory. It represents the point of absolute divine unity (نقطه وحدت), which is simple, indivisible, and acts as the true origin and center of the universe's circle. Just as a single dark mole contrasts with and enhances the beauty of a face, this singular, hidden divine reality is the essence from which the entire cosmos and the human heart emanate, while the essence itself remains strictly one and devoid of any multiplicity.
